Transaction 623a589ce34cf9f7cb7e14385dc95f09ea0ea3aeda13a64f95295db3973bd70f

1 Input
2 Outputs
  • 623a589ce34cf9f7cb7e14385dc95f09ea0ea3aeda13a64f95295db3973bd70f:0
  • value  5549755
    address  34bfRbboP2LBzhtaUG8123AhrKbaDwZgDF
  • 623a589ce34cf9f7cb7e14385dc95f09ea0ea3aeda13a64f95295db3973bd70f:1
  • value  45824
    address  bc1qes0jq6mn339s4kcg5mmh6g3chsugn47fjchexp